Exploring Different Types of Pins for Hijab
Choosing the right pin depends on your fabric, styling method, and personal taste. Straight pins are classic and versatile. They work well for most materials and are often topped with pearl or round heads. Safety pins offer stronger security, perfect for active days or slippery scarves.
Magnetic pins are a favorite for those who want to avoid damaging delicate fabrics. With no sharp edges, they work through magnetism to hold scarves in place. Decorative pins, like brooches or jeweled styles, make a fashion statement and are great for special events or formal occasions.
How to Match Pins with Different Hijab Fabrics
Different hijab materials require different pins. Jersey and cotton scarves work best with safety pins or thick straight pins since they’re heavier and hold shape well. Chiffon, silk, or satin hijabs are delicate and benefit from fine straight pins or magnetic ones to prevent snags and holes.
Choosing the right texture and thickness ensures your hijab stays secure without damaging the fabric. Always test your pins on a corner of your scarf to make sure they’re safe. Matching pin type with fabric helps extend the life of your scarves and keeps your look polished all day.

Hijab Pin Styling Techniques for Every Look
Hijab styling isn’t just about how the scarf is wrapped—it’s also about pin placement and type. For everyday wear, a small pin under the chin gives structure and keeps things secure. You can also use a magnetic pin at the side for a clean, modern silhouette with no visible pins.
For layered looks, especially with longer scarves, decorative pins placed near the shoulder or temple can serve as both function and ornamentation. Playing with pin placement lets you get creative and adds a personal touch. Don’t be afraid to try new positions until you find what works best for you.

Organizing Your Pin Collection the Smart Way
Keeping your pins neat and easy to access can save time and stress. Use small boxes with compartments to separate your pins by type—safety, magnetic, decorative, etc. This also prevents them from tangling, getting lost, or damaging each other. A little organization makes a big difference.
Pin cushions are another smart storage solution, especially for straight pins. They keep everything visible and within reach while protecting pinheads from wear.
